A delightful 1930s extended terraced house located in the sought after Willingdon Village having superb views of the picturesque South Downs. This lovely home features an L-shaped open plan kitchen/diner with access to a lounge and also has sliding doors to the rear garden, a most comfortable sitting room enjoying the southerly views of the South Downs and a downstairs cloakroom/wc. On the first floor are two double sized bedrooms, a bathroom with separate wc and an office/study area with a staircase leading to the spacious main bedroom. The property has a gas fired central heating system, double glazing, an approximately 70' rear garden, which has access to the garage located in a block and a lovely front garden enjoying the southerly downland views.
Willingdon Village is a beautiful location to live being within walking distance of Old Church Street and access to the South Downs providing many countryside walks with stunning views. Local shops are close by as well as bus services connecting to Eastbourne Town Centre and the mainline railway station at Polegate High Street, The property is offered with NO ONGOING CHAIN.
